Special Agent Dale Harbolt was killed in an airplane crash while flying a department Cessna from Dallas to Oklahoma City.
The plane crashed in a residential area as he attempted to make an emergency landing at Wiley Post Airport after running low on fuel.
Agent Harbolt had served with the ATF for almost 11 years and eight years with the Oklahoma City Police Department. He was survived by his wife, son, & daughter. He had also served in the US Army.
